What is Face wash?

“Instead of using typical soap to wash our face, we use a liquid called a face wash. ”

Face washes are water-based formulations that are available in gel and foam forms. They are most effective on skin types that are oily and acne prone. In comparison to a cleanser, a face wash is slightly rougher. A face wash is a foamy solution that is used to remove deep-seated filth and grime, which cleans and refreshes the skin, making it an ideal daily treatment for clear, unbroken skin. There are several types of face wash, including liquid, cream, Gel, Powder, and bars.

The activity of the Face wash – A face wash’s primary function is to clear your skin of dirt, sweat, bacteria, excess sebum, dead skin cells, and leftover makeup. Clean skin has the fewest skin problems and absorbs treatment products more efficiently. Regular soap has an alkaline pH, which strips away the protective oils, leaving the skin sensitive and dry.

Face washes provide a moisturizing effect that, after removing particles, leaves the face feeling incredibly hydrated.

Types of Face Wash

We have a variety of face washes available in the market. So that you may get a better understanding and utilize the one that is best for your skin.

Facewash comes in a variety of types: –

  • Gel facewash – These face washes have a gel-like texture and are made to deep clean, unclog clogged pores, and eliminate acne-causing germs. It’s the ideal option for oily, acne-prone skin.
  • Foam facewash – Foaming face washes produce a thick lather, are excellent at removing extra sebum, impurities, and pollutants, and are suitable for oily skin.
  • Cream facewash – To avoid removing the skin’s natural oils, these face washes are gentle on the skin and have a thick, creamy consistency. For sensitive and dry skin.
  • Powder facewash – Face washes with powder are especially good for people with sensitive skin who want to remove dead skin cells without using an intense scrub.
  • Whitening facewash – While the ingredients in facewash help in tan removal and improved skin texture, they don’t lighten your original skin tone.
  • Detoxifying facewash – This type of facewash helps in detoxifying skin from toxins and all impurities, and the ingredients help in clearing the skin from deep within as it retrieves the skin toxins.

What is a cleanser?

Cleansers clean your skin but have a thicker texture compared to face wash. Consider creamy or milky gels, oils, and balms. A cleanser is gentler than a face wash. A cleanser is much more moisturizing too. Furthermore, face cleanser solutions are created with components that try to nourish your skin, balance your complexion, and increase moisture levels.

The activity of the cleanser

A face cleanser is a skincare product that clears the pores and stops skin issues like acne by removing makeup, dead skin cells, oil, debris, and other pollutants from the skin. It contains less soap and is creamier than a face wash. For a dry face, a cleanser is much better than a face wash as it keeps the skin soft. The pH of the skin is normally between 4.5 and 6.5. When you cleanse your skin, an interaction happens between the cleanser, the skin’s moisture barrier, and the pH of the skin.  It is a non-foaming liquid that does not need to be rinsed away.

Facial cleansers come in different forms and choosing the one that best works for your skin type and your lifestyle is helpful.

Types of Face cleanser – With the variety of alternatives, face cleansers available in the market. Might be difficult to choose the finest cleanser for your skin.

  • Gel cleansers – are transparent and gel-like in texture. Most of the products provide deep-cleaning and exfoliating qualities, perfect for oily, acne-prone skin.
  • Cream cleansers – are typically thicker and can be hydrated, cleansing without removing the face’s natural oils—ideal for dry or sensitive skin.
  • Foam cleansers – Foam cleansers are gentle and excellent in removing excess oil, making them ideal for combination skin.
  • Oil Cleansers – Oil cleansers clear impurities from your skin without disrupting the oil balance.
  • Powder Cleansers – Mix with the water. The produced creamy paste gently exfoliates and cleanses your skin – ideal for oily & Sensitive skin.
  • Clay Cleansers – The clay cleanser will absorb all extra oils and pollutants. This procedure removes any toxins that are clogging your pores. Best for Combination or oily skin.
